复制实现Redis集群间数据复制(redis集群之间)
2023-06-13 09:12:19 时间
Redis是一种开源的用来构建关键值存储器的内存数据库。它能够存储字符串、列表、哈希表及设置等数据类型,通 extends 功能使它也可以存储图片、音视频等复杂对象。为了满足IT的大数据需求,Redis提供复制功能,实现不同的机器之间数据的同步。
针对Redis集群,复制实现是上百台机器上的大规模数据的Optimistic replication的有效核心实现方案。这种方式能让数据在一台机器上被修改,并通过同步另一台机器,实现在集群之间的及时更新,确保不同机器上可以访问到最新数据。
Redis主从复制在对数据进行同步时,采用Master-Slave架构,Master主服务器负责接收客户端的请求并存储数据,Slave服务器负责与Master同步数据、根据客户端的请求提供数据。当Master服务器出现问题时,可以将Slave服务器提升为新的Master,实现故障转移。
复制实现的Redis集群间数据复制的基本步骤如下:
首先确定一台机器作为复制的源服务器,另一台机器作为复制的目标服务器,接着使用redis-cli客户端输入如下命令,表示将源服务器的数据复制到目标服务器:
COPY source_ip:port target_ip:port
``` 然后在源服务器上定义一个同步周期,可以使用如下命令:
SETSYNC period 2
这表示每2s执行一次数据复制,然后可以使用如下命令查看复制进度:
SHOWSYNCPROGRESS
若数据复制进度已完成,查看显示的形式为100%,则表示数 据已成功从源服务器复制到目标服务器。
以上就是Redis集群间数据复制的实现方式,Redis复制功能保证 在多台Redis服务器之间,数据复制得到保持一致,使用Redis集群能满足各种大数据需求,将是企业大数据发展的重要方向之一。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 复制实现Redis集群间数据复制(redis集群之间)
相关文章
- Redis迁移:把大数据转移到新的生态圈(redis的迁移)
- Linux下登录Redis: 简单而高效的操作方式(linux登录redis)
- 使用Redis实现数据增量管理(redis追加数据)
- Redis主备配置简介:实现高可用方案(redis主备配置)
- Redis让你的数据更安全可靠(若依redis存哪些数据)
- 查看Redis系统运行情况(查询当前redis情况)
- 深入浅出查询Redis集群(查询redis集群)
- 数据深入浅出本机查看Redis数据的步骤指南(本机查看redis)
- 如何快捷地在服务器上安装Redis(服务器怎么装redis)
- 清理Redis缓存释放内存的关键步骤(清redis 缓存)
- 用Redis管理文件数据库(文件数据库 redis)
- TP5使用Redis实现更高性能的数据存储(tp5 连接redis)
- 单台Redis性能调优攻克极致性能的关键(单台redis性能调优)
- 深度探索加入Redis集群的实践经验(加入redis集群)
- 构建公网Redis集群,实现高性能连接(公网redis集群连接)
- 简易指南快速搭建Redis客户端(如何redis客户端)
- 商城项目中,Redis的妙用(商城项目redis作用)
- 深入理解Redis默认存储方式分析(redis 默认存储方式)
- 性基于Redis集群的可用性设置(redis集群设置可用)
- 构建高效可靠的Redis集群消息推送体系(redis集群消息推送)
- Redis集群机房最佳选择(redis 集群机房)
- 部署手动部署Redis集群,实现高可用(redis集群 手动)
- 一窥 Redis 的优秀之处(redis 长处)
- 利用Redis锁实现安全的数据存储(redis锁数据结构)
- 设置Redis永久存储解决过期时间设置难题(redis过期时间 永久)
- Redis集群架构下实现JWT鉴权(redis集群jwt)
- Redis脚本编写入门指南(redis脚本编写教程)
- Redis是否会消耗内存(redis耗内存吗)
- 解决Redis连接速度缓慢问题(redis连接缓慢)